Aging changes the human body in ways that affect metabolism, digestion, muscle maintenance, immunity, brain function, hormone regulation and nutrient absorption. Traditional nutrition guidelines often focus on preventing deficiency diseases but geronutrition goes much further.
Geronutrition is the science of using targeted nutrition, longevity nutrients, metabolic support and healthy aging strategies to improve quality of life as the body ages.
The term combines:
- “Gero” → aging
- “Nutrition” → nourishment and metabolic support
Geronutrition studies how nutritional strategies can help:
- Preserve muscle mass
- Support cognitive performance
- Improve immune resilience
- Reduce inflammation
- Protect mitochondrial function
- Support bone density
- Improve energy metabolism
- Promote healthy aging and longevity

Why Geronutrition Matters After 40, 50 & 60
Aging alters nearly every major biological system.
Common Age-Related Nutritional Changes
| Biological Change | Nutritional Effect |
|---|---|
| Reduced stomach acid | Lower B12 and mineral absorption |
| Muscle loss | Higher protein requirements |
| Hormonal decline | Altered metabolism and energy |
| Chronic inflammation | Increased oxidative stress |
| Reduced mitochondrial efficiency | Lower energy production |
| Appetite decline | Lower calorie and nutrient intake |
| Reduced insulin sensitivity | Higher metabolic disease risk |
These changes explain why older adults often require:
- Higher protein intake
- More micronutrient density
- Better hydration
- Anti-inflammatory nutrients
- Targeted supplementation

Inflammaging & Cellular Aging

One of the most important concepts in geronutrition is inflammaging.
Inflammaging refers to chronic low-grade inflammation associated with aging.
This process is linked to:
- Cardiovascular disease
- Cognitive decline
- Frailty
- Sarcopenia
- Insulin resistance
- Metabolic dysfunction
Anti-Inflammaging Nutritional Strategies
| Strategy | Purpose |
|---|---|
| Omega-3 intake | Reduce inflammatory signaling |
| Polyphenol-rich foods | Antioxidant support |
| Fiber intake | Gut microbiome support |
| Reduced ultra-processed foods | Lower oxidative stress |
| Healthy sleep | Hormonal regulation |

Muscle Loss, Sarcopenia & Protein Needs

Age-related muscle loss is known as sarcopenia.
This is one of the most serious aging-related conditions because it affects:
- Mobility
- Strength
- Balance
- Independence
- Metabolic health
- Fall risk
Protein Needs Comparison
| Age Group | Approximate Protein Priority |
|---|---|
| Younger adults | Standard maintenance |
| Older adults | Higher protein density |
| Physically active seniors | Elevated muscle-support focus |
Geronutrition emphasizes:
- Protein timing
- Amino acid quality
- Resistance training
- Recovery nutrition

Mitochondrial Health & Energy Production

Mitochondria are often described as the energy-producing structures of cells.
As aging progresses, mitochondrial efficiency may decline.
This can contribute to:
- Fatigue
- Reduced endurance
- Cognitive slowing
- Lower metabolic efficiency
Nutrients Commonly Associated With Mitochondrial Support
| Nutrient | Potential Role |
|---|---|
| CoQ10 | Cellular energy support |
| Magnesium | ATP production |
| Alpha-lipoic acid | Antioxidant protection |
| B vitamins | Energy metabolism |
| Creatine | Cellular energy recycling |

Frequently Asked Questions (FAQs)
What is geronutrition?
Geronutrition is the science of nutrition and aging. It studies how nutrients, diet, supplements, and metabolism influence healthy aging, longevity, muscle preservation, cognition, and metabolic health.
Why is nutrition important after 60?
After 60, nutrient absorption, muscle protein synthesis, metabolic flexibility, and mitochondrial efficiency often decline. Proper nutrition helps support strength, cognition, immunity, and overall health.
What are the best nutrients for healthy aging?
Commonly recommended healthy aging nutrients include protein, omega-3 fatty acids, magnesium, vitamin D, vitamin B12, calcium, antioxidants, and polyphenol-rich foods.
Is geronutrition the same as anti-aging nutrition?
They overlap, but geronutrition is broader and more science-focused. It studies how nutrition affects biological aging, longevity, inflammation, metabolism, and age-related decline.
Can supplements slow aging?
Some supplements may support healthy aging processes, but no supplement can completely stop aging. Evidence-based approaches focus on nutrition, exercise, sleep, metabolic health, and long-term lifestyle consistency.

How does aging affect nutrient absorption?
Aging may reduce stomach acid production, digestive efficiency, and nutrient absorption, especially for vitamin B12, calcium, magnesium, and protein.
What is the best diet for healthy aging?
Mediterranean-style eating patterns rich in whole foods, protein, healthy fats, fiber, and antioxidant-rich foods are commonly associated with healthy aging.
What supplements are popular for longevity?
Popular longevity supplements include fish oil, creatine, magnesium, vitamin D3, CoQ10, collagen peptides, and probiotics.
What causes muscle loss with aging?
Age-related muscle loss, called sarcopenia, is influenced by reduced activity, lower protein intake, hormonal changes, inflammation, and altered muscle protein synthesis.
